## Signing artifacts for Brinepipe plugins

Quick note for plugin authors: Brinepipe's queue compacts logs aggressively, so unsigned plugin messages may be dropped during compaction without a trace. Always sign your plugin artifacts before publishing so the broker can verify them post-compaction. Sign your bundle with the key shown below.

deploy key for kajof-fajop: bky6_gDHw9Q

# Flagpole Data Stores

Welcome! Flagpole (our feature-flag rollout framework) keeps everything in two places: flag definitions live in the config store, and rollout telemetry lands in the events store. As a contractor you'll mostly touch the config store — that's where targeting rules and percentage ramps sit. To connect your local tooling to the staging config store, use the connection string below.

primary connection of yagep-kahip = redis://giliel_svc:zYiKsLL2PLpfPL@db-348f.xolmarsys.corp:5432/fenwyn

16:05 — Restock planner (Stockwren) began emitting duplicate route plans after the Calloway depot sync. Root cause: idempotency key dropped in the new batch writer. Duplicates caused double-dispatch for 11 machines in the Ferndale zone. Mitigation: writer rolled back, dedupe sweep run, routes reconciled by 16:40. Fix lands next cycle. The rolled-back artifact is identified by the token below.

session token of kageg-tahop = htk14_af3c1ccccb7dcf

Handover: Tarn build migration

I've moved about 70% of the Quillbeam targets to the hermetic Veldt build system. Remaining work: the codegen step still reaches out to the network, so those targets stay on the legacy path until the fetcher is vendored. For support: if a customer build fails with a sandbox violation, it's almost always an undeclared input — ask them to rerun with tracing enabled and attach the manifest. The full migration checklist and known-issues table live here.

operations page: https://jenkins.zemvarcloud.local/job/merge_requests/repo/build/73930b4b30f0a8ed